Tour description

Do you want a different approach to a walking tour? Do you like free food samples? Then this is your tour! Join me in discovering Madrid in an unconventional way - from new to old! The tour will start in Puerta de Alcalá, the iconic gate that used to give access to the walled city of Madrid. For the first half of the tour we will be exploring the city’s newer buildings and monuments - those from the Borbones dynasty. As we progress throughout the tour, we will go deeper into the history and culture of this wonderful city and learn about Madrid de los Austrias, the oldest quarter in the city. We will finish the tour in Palacio Real, the palace that sits where the city’s first building once was. Fuente de Cibeles, Puerta del Sol, Plaza Mayor, Mercado de San Miguel, Plaza de la Villa, Catedral de la Almudena… The list goes on and on. From the impressive sights to the fascinating stories, this tour will captivate your attention from the very beginning. To sweeten and enhance your experience I will provide some free typical sweets and candy from Madrid and Spain that will give you a taste of one of the best gastronomies in the world. How much does this tour cost?

Free tours do not have a set price, instead, each person gives the guru at the end of the tour the amount that he or she considers appropriate (these usually range from €10 to $50 depending on satisfaction with the tour).
